Take responsibility for your choices.  Do not blame anyone else.


You might have noticed that recently I have not been able to shut up about my surgery, and this post will be no exception.  I often have felt that it is extremely unfair that I have a bone disease that one in a hundred thousand people have.  It is, of course, but my body is still in my domain of power.  I can control how I handle the stress and the pain.  Sometimes I even think that I wouldn't change my bones if I could because they are uniquely mine and they have probably made me a more empathetic person than I would have been.
